The `w800rf32` platform supports X10 RF binary sensors such as Palm Pad
|
|
remotes, key chain remotes, Hawkeye motion detectors, and many, many other X10 RF devices.
|
|
Some that have specifically been used with this are the KR19A keychain, MS16A motion detector
|
|
and the RSS18 four button wall mount keypad.

Binary sensors have only two states - "on" and "off". Many door or window
|
|
opening sensors will send a signal each time the door/window is open or closed.
|
|
However, depending on their hardware or on their purpose,
|
|
some sensors are only able to signal their "on" state:
|
|
|
|
- Most motion sensors send a signal each time they detect motion. They stay "on" for a few seconds and go back to sleep, ready to signal other motion events. Usually, they do not send a signal when they go back to sleep.
|
|
|
|
For those devices, use the *off_delay* parameter.
|
|
It defines a delay after which a device will go back to an "Off" state.
|
|
That "Off" state will be fired internally by Home Assistant, just as if
|
|
the device fired it by itself. If a motion sensor can only send signals
|
|
once every 5 seconds, sets the *off_delay* parameter to *seconds: 5*.
